if you want to protect the paint i suggest not getting a bra for the front at all.

a bra will hide the paint under it from the sun , if you leave it on long enough, when you do decide to remove it you have paint that has different levels of sun faded.


be smart don't buy one
 






but if i don't buy one, all the rocks and insects will surely chip my paint away...

cuz i'll be hitting the highway big time this month's end.
 






Buy a bugguard for the front. I drive on the highway all the time and haven't chipped up my front end. Bras are the devil. Very bad. I had one before on my car and they just soak up the water from rain and snow. Not a good thing.
 






As mentioned before, bras will destroy your paint faster than any bug or rock. If you are conserned about protecting your paint you should look for anyone in your local aera that installs "clear bras." The clear bra is a vinal overlay that is applied to the front of the vehicle to protect the paint. It is not perminant and will not hurt the paint.
 






Definitely stay away from the car bra's. As said before, they can mess up your paint a lot worse than some bugs or rocks. The Bugflectors do wonders for protecting the leading edge of your hood from bugs and rock chips.
 






I really don't see a problem with putting them on if your just using it during your road trip. If your only gonna have it on a week or two, it's not gonna make a difference. I had one on my X for 2 weeks for a trip to Florida.....saved many a bugs from being splatterd on the grill or imbedded in my radiator. I used the Wolf brand.
 






Try not the use the bra. The dirt and whatever trapped under the bra will totally destroy your paint because of the sandpaper action from the dirt and powered by the wind.
